What is this? A cooked chicken product may have small bits of oven-cleaning tablet in it.

What's happening? Some of these roast chickens were baked with a cleaning tablet still inside the oven.

Does this affect me? If you bought this cooked chicken in France, it could be affected.

What should I do? Stop eating it and take it back to the shop. Ask the shop or your doctor if you feel unwell.
